The Historical Context of Gambling
Gambling has been a part of human civilization for centuries, often intertwined with cultural, religious, and social practices. Its roots can be traced back to ancient civilizations, such as the Chinese, where games of chance were used in religious ceremonies, and the Romans, who organized betting on gladiatorial contests. The historical significance of gambling reflects societal values, showcasing how different cultures have approached games of chance as either recreational or spiritual endeavors. As societies evolved, so did the regulations surrounding gambling. In many cultures, it transitioned from informal social practices to organized activities with structured rules. The establishment of state-sponsored lotteries and regulated casinos indicates a shift towards acceptance, reflecting changing attitudes. Understanding these historical contexts provides insight into why certain cultures embrace gambling while others view it with skepticism or outright prohibition.
The impact of colonization also influenced gambling customs worldwide. European powers often imposed their own gambling practices onto colonized regions, leading to the melding of different cultural approaches. As a result, local traditions around games of chance have adapted, leading to a diverse range of gambling customs that reflect a blend of indigenous and colonial influences. This historical perspective sets the stage for current cultural views and practices related to gambling.
Cultural Attitudes and Beliefs
Cultural attitudes toward gambling vary significantly from one region to another, shaped by religious beliefs, historical experiences, and societal norms. In many Western cultures, for example, gambling is often viewed as a form of entertainment, with an emphasis on personal freedom and responsibility. The rise of casinos and online gambling platforms has further normalized these activities, fostering a consumerist approach where people engage in betting as a leisure pursuit.
Conversely, in some Asian cultures, gambling is often approached with caution or outright condemnation. For instance, countries like China have a complex relationship with gambling, where it is culturally significant but also seen as a potential moral hazard. The Chinese New Year festivities highlight this duality, with practices like playing Mahjong acting as both cultural heritage and potential pathways to addiction. This cultural dichotomy illustrates how deeply ingrained beliefs about luck and fate can shape gambling practices.
Religious perspectives also play a crucial role in shaping cultural views on gambling. For instance, in Islamic culture, gambling is strictly prohibited due to its association with chance and the potential for financial ruin. This prohibition has resulted in a unique landscape of informal gaming practices that exist outside state regulation. Understanding these cultural and religious influences is essential to grasp the global tapestry of gambling attitudes.

Regional Differences in Gambling Practices
Regional differences in gambling practices are striking and reflect a diverse array of cultural attitudes and legal frameworks. For example, in Las Vegas, the United States, gambling is synonymous with entertainment, characterized by lavish casinos and themed resorts that attract millions of visitors. This vibrant gambling culture is a testament to the acceptance and normalization of betting as a legitimate leisure activity.
On the other hand, in places like Japan, gambling is heavily regulated, with specific games like Pachinko being popular while others remain prohibited. The cultural significance of these games illustrates how traditional values influence gambling practices. The Japanese approach emphasizes skill and strategy over chance, showcasing a unique blend of cultural heritage with modern gaming trends.
In contrast, many Scandinavian countries have embraced state-run gambling as a means to control addiction and generate revenue for social programs. This regulatory model contrasts sharply with other regions where gambling is largely unregulated, leading to potential exploitation. By examining these regional differences, we can appreciate the intricate relationship between culture, legislation, and gambling practices across the globe.
